Output 45983a4b88840c816b803131c5006ff91c037b139f3551a48d292b6ea7bc2591:3

value
11819727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583b11222ea6bf8d96c762db261db763e631f71c OP_EQUAL
address
39jY9U2zLDAaXKasCnYJRpiiW2doWreZsx
transaction
45983a4b88840c816b803131c5006ff91c037b139f3551a48d292b6ea7bc2591